P Rankings - A ranking system that judges that potential amount of radiation in the planets atmosphere and surface. P1 is the lowest while P5 is the most highest known to the Council.
Radiate - Someone who can manipulate radiation in some way or form.
The Council - A group of beings that are often portrayed as The Police of the Universe. They consist of some galactic empire figureheads, and wise men of the universe. Such beings also include the Myriads, a group of humanoid sentient beings that make up most of the Council.
Myriads - A very colorful humanoid, they almost exist in a state of controlled energy, resulting in their varying colors. Tom meets one (male) on the spacecraft from Earth, who gives him a new cybernetic arm that may still hold some secrets.
Tom - A male human that originates from Earth. Possessing an AI of unknown origin, and a cybernetic arm as well. Abducted due to his genetic mutation that allowed for Liquid Manipulation, he arrives on a P3 Prison Planet called Vernier, where he also undergoes a mutation experience called the Progression. Borin - The first male dwarf that Tom meets on the surface of Vernier, in a crevice almost unexplored by most due to it's depth. Borin is a radiation manipulator, a side-effect from living for generations on the prison planet. He is a bumbling, but serious warrior who only wears armor to show off his massive potential strength. He originates from other planet, but was put on Vernier by the Council due to his past-criminal status of a Space Pirate.

Mother - A female human that gave birth to Tom, but not the reason for him being alive to this date. She is 'abducted' the night before the Ethereal Door Incident, where only those with genetic mutations could see the said door. Just where could she be?
Fang - A female wolf that has been Tom's lifelong companion. She was able to find the Ethereal Door, and was subsequently abducted with Tom. In one chapter, it is hinted she may have been changed in some way, but it is for certain she is on Vernier as well. But where?
Vernier - The P3 planet Tom arrives on via Council spacecraft. Essentially a prison planet for those the Council deemed unfit for society, or too much of a hassle to execute. The reason for Tom being dropped off is the latter.
Kareb - Borin's younger brother who was once upon a time, the chief of the town under the sands, Dunheim. He confiscated some crystal dust from some traveling merchants, a very dangerous and high performance drug, and became a demented idiot who can't do anything on his own.
Dunheim - The town beneath the sands. Borin's birthplace and Kareb's as well. This is the first sign of civilization Tom encounters, and the technology of the town is all mechanical, and not powered by any form of electricity. Basically, science fiction is almost nonexistent, where only uni-dimensional trash cans are installed to get rid of waste and the like.
Ulia - The chieftain of the town Dunheim, and a woman blacksmith, which explains her hairless face. She is the first to ask Tom for help to the problem of crystal dust. She has some connection to Borin and Kareb, and it goes way back. But just what is that connection?
Forlom - A major city found in the Great Waste, a massive expansion of desert that is home to very small clans of Dwarves. Forlom is one of the few cities that still showcases the technology that once flew above the planet, as the Upper City can be seen as a ship, or a floating city. The Upper City can be considered the 'must go to' area, as only the best of the best of warriors, scholars, and radiates can go to the Upper City, excluding the nobility and other wealthy people. The Lower City is made up of many denizens of the Great Waste that have flocked here to become adventurers, or trade on underground markets. The Lower City is not made up entirely of glass, unlike the Upper City, since the sandstorms will sometimes break the glass elevator shafts that once stood high above the city.

Mana - An elven radiate illusionist that is close to Borin, and greets Tom in a way that will change his body forever. She loves the color black, and as far as Tom knows, is a girl with only dreams in her chest. She becomes Tom's mentor on the ways of radiation. She owns a worldwide business that isn't known by most, due to the place's broken down appearances. Mana's Emporium is only known to people who have proven themselves, in one way or another.
Ganmar - The kingdom of the beast-kin. Being mainly a forest, it has an area comparable to the island(s) of the Philippines back on Earth. Multiple islands can be seen from the coast, and the huge forest that inhabits the mainland is in fact, the capital city of Ganmar, Tortine.
Lignus - The racial term for the beast race that evolved from lizards. They are in a long-term feud with the feline race of the beast-kin, the Fleunas.
Fleunas - The racial term for the beast race that evolved from the feline family of the mammals. They consist of lion, tiger, alley cat, house cat, leopard, and any other felines. They are in a long term turf war with the beast-kin Lignus, the lizard people.
